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
076 5024054887 66 9788972440 976669
653 227374 20771711
653 227374 20771711
1748 82435 23912
All about undefined
Interested in learning more?
653 227374 20771711
1748 82435 23912
See more
01740 93743 8938577
543538 28129014188 2186952276
See more
174157 99207 332781
269 6290754077 72 24392945
See more